Control of swing or swing speed:

(under subclass 309) Apparatus including means to automatically regulate the cyclical lateral movement of the dredger suction pipe or of the vessel which carries the dredger. (1) Note. This subclass includes subject matter in which the automatic control system varies the speed of the swing motors (responsive to the pressure in the fluid circuit driving the cutterhead or to the fluid pressure in the dredge pump), and consequently the swinging movement of the ladder, in order to maintain a constant load upon the cutterhead or to the fluid pressure in the dredge pump.

(2) Note. In actual operation, a dredge swings from side to side, using the port spud as a pivot. The action of the dredge is controlled by swing cables attached to swing anchors. To advance, after the swing of the dredge has stopped, the starboard spud is dropped as the port spud is raised.
